Lakeshore Launches 2023 Summer Student Recruitment
Posted on Tuesday, December 20, 2022 01:45 PM
The Municipality of Lakeshore’s summer student job positions are now open for applications. All local youth who are 16 years of age or older and returning to school in September of 2023 are eligible to apply. Applications will be accepted until Monday, February 20, 2023, at 4:30 PM.

Lakeshore Takes Action on Greenhouses
Posted on Wednesday, December 14, 2022 10:34 AM
Greenhouses to be regulated under Official Plan and Zoning By-law, reports expected in early 2023
At the meeting on Tuesday, December 13, 2022, Lakeshore Council took a step toward regulating large-scale greenhouse facilities in the Municipality.

Phase 2 of Belle River Dredging Project to Start Monday
Posted on Saturday, December 10, 2022 09:32 AM
Access to beach and river impacted, work expected to be completed by mid-January
Contractors for the Municipality of Lakeshore will begin phase 2 of dredging of the mouth of Belle River on Monday, December 12, 2022. The work will take place at the mouth of the lake and on the beach (see key map below) and is expected to be completed by mid-January.
